Select a High-Security Door

The choice of door for your business plays a crucial role in enhancing its security and safety. Commercial storefronts typically utilize various door materials such as aluminum, glass, steel, wood, and fiberglass. Each material offers unique advantages when it comes to security.

Steel doors stand out as the most secure option due to their weight and resistance to break-ins. However, they tend to come with a higher price tag compared to other alternatives. On the other hand, aluminum doors are favored for their lightweight nature, energy efficiency, and customization options.

Add Robust Locks

Ensuring top-notch locks are in place is important to boost the security of your entrances. Commercial doors offer a range of lock options, such as multi-point locks, electromechanical locks, and biometric scanners. These locks are prevalent choices among commercial establishments due to their reliability and resilience.

Get Regular Door Inspections

Regularly checking and upkeeping your business doors is crucial to upholding their security and safety standards. As time passes, wear and tear can compromise their integrity, potentially affecting their functionality. That’s why it’s important to conduct routine inspections to spot any signs of damage like cracks or dents.

Additionally, keep hinges and locks well-lubricated to ensure smooth operation. You should also verify the weatherstripping to maintain a secure seal. If any components are worn out or damaged, promptly replace them. Taking these steps will make certain your business doors maintain their security and protect your property.

Ensure Your Employees are Trained on Security Procedures

Your staff serves as the primary safeguard for your business’ security and providing them with comprehensive training on security procedures is crucial. This includes instructions on correctly securing and unlocking doors, identifying suspicious behavior, and responding to emergencies.

Your employees should be well-versed in the security features of your business’ doors, including the types of locks and any installed alarms or sensors. It’s equally important to establish a concise protocol for handling security breaches or natural disasters.
